Type of Coating Insulation Reference

Insulation-enamelled Name

Thermal Level℃

(working time 2000h)

Code Name GB Code ANSI. TYPE
Polyurethane enamelled wire 130 UEW QA MW75C
Polyester enamelled wire 155 PEW QZ MW5C
Polyester-imide enamelled wire 180 EIW QZY MW30C
Polyester-imide and polyamide-imide double coated enameled wire 200

EIWH

(DFWF)

QZY/XY MW35C
Polyamide-imide enamelled wire 220 AIW QXY MW81C
